4.0 HPSR 09-09-2004Ci t~ver MEMORANDUM TO: Heritage Preservation Commission FROM: Stephen Rohlf, Building and Environmental Administrator DATE: September 9, 2004 SUBJECT: Items on the September 28, 2004 Planning Commission Agenda Attached to this memo is the September 28th Planning Commission Agenda and a map showing the locations of the requests. The City's recent Archaeological Modeling and the State Historical Society Office's (SHPO) list of known archaeological site were referenced in regards to the items on the Planning Commission's agenda. The following is a summary of the agenda items and their potential to conflict with any known cultural, historical or archaeological resources: 5.1 -Plat of Windsor Meadows - (P 04-18) -There are no known SHPO sites and the model shows the site as low to moderate archaeological potential. Since there will be grading associated with the plat improvements -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.2 -Parking lot expansion for Guardian Angels - (CU 04-26) -Although no known archaeological sites have been identified on the property, the project will involve grading and the potential to unearth something of archaeological significance.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.3 -Home occupation - (CU 04-01) - No issues. 5.4 -Change in land use designation - (LU 04-03) - No issues. 5.5 -Rezoning (ZC 04-07) - No issues. 5.6 -Plat of Jackson Avenue Villas (P 04-16) -The property involved with this request is rated as having low to moderate potential for containing archaeological significance. Staff is not recommending archaeological testing prior to approval of the plat, but -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.7 -Plat of Jackson Square - (P 04-19) -The archaeological model shows this property as a low potential area for archaeological resources and SHPO does not list any know archaeological sites for this area. The HPC has already made their opinion that the area has local historic significance known to the City Council. -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.8 -Plat of Bluff Block - (P 04-20) -The archaeological model shows this property as a low potential area for archaeological resources and SHPO does not list any know archaeological sites for this area. The HPC has already made their opinion that the area has local historic significance known to the City Council. -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.9 -NAPA Auto Facility - (CU 04-25) - No known SHPO sites involved with this request, but the archaeological model indicates the site has a moderate to high potential for archaeological significance (mainly due to being on a bluff adjacent to a main travel route, the Mississippi River). Since the site was previously disturbed by the plat of Mississippi Ridge, staff is not recommending archaeological testing prior to approval, but -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.10 -Medical Building - (CU 04-27) - No known SHPO sites and the model indicates low potential for archaeological significance, but grading will be involved. -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.11 -Plat of Carson Business Park - (P 04-11) -There are no known SHPO sites on this property, but the model indicates high potential for archaeological significance. The plat improvements involved with this request will result in extensive grading of the property, but the property has already been previously disturbed. Therefore staff is not recommending archaeological testing prior to approval, but -Staff recommends the standard condition listed below is placed on this request. 5.12 -Ordinance Amendment - (AO 04-03) - No issues. Standard Condition: "Any item or condition found that indicates the site is likely to yield information important to prehistory or history shall be reported to the city immediately. Further, the city reserves the right to stop work authorized in its approval until the site is appropriately investigated and work is authorized to continue by the city."
